Last Summer at Mars Hill by Elizabeth Hand
This is Elizabeth Hand's long-awaited collection of short stories, centered around her Nebula and World Fantasy Award-winning novella The Last Summer at Mars Hill. There are 12 pieces in all here, ranging from those first published in places like Interzone and Pulphouse to a two-page poem taken from the pages of Asimov's. Although many readers may be familiar with Hand's longer works, such as Glimmering or Waking the Moon, here she shows that she's a master of short fiction as well. Her stylish prose and keen insights make for some wonderful stories. --Craig E. Engler

Contents:
Last Summer at Mars Hill (1994)
The Erl-King (1993)
Justice (1993)
Dionysus Dendrites (1993) poem
The Have-Nots (1992)
In the Month of Athyr (1992)
Engels Unaware (1992)
The Bacchae (1991)
Snow on Sugar Mountain (1991)
On the Town Route (1989)
The Boy in the Tree (1989)
Prince of Flowers (1988)
